Headline: Four-game set could determine Phils’ fate
The Major Players: Jamie Moyer, Chase Utley, Pat Burrell, Ryan Madson, JC Romero, Ben Sheets, Corey Hart, Rickie Weeks
The Venue: Citizens Bank Park, Philadelphia, Pa.
The Number: 3.5 games behind (Mets) NL East; 4 games behind (Brewers) Wild Card
Every game from hereon is starting to take “must-win” status, and tonight is no joke. The Brewers are in for an important four-game set, and Jamie Moyer comes out on three-days rest to try and beat the Crew. He has never pitched on three-days rest for the Phils, the last time doing it in 2004, a seven-run slaughter in five innings.
Ben-eath The Sheets: Ben Sheets hasn’t faced the Phillies this season. The goal: Be patient. Take strikes and balls early and get him into high counts. By the seventh inning, he sould be raring for a bad inning. In the seventh hitters are .351 against him. In the sixth, they’re .292.
Not A Prince: Prince Fielder is hitting .176 in September.
Good When Close: The Brewers are 28-14 in one-run games
Phillies: Jamie Moyer (13-7) 3.64 ERA
Brewers: Ben Sheets (13-7) 2.82 ERA
